We're glad about being able to announce our very latest OFP release, the Eurocopter EC-135 SHS.

release06_100kb.jpg

It resembles a model used by the German Bundeswehr for flight training of helicopter pilots, hence the Schulungshubschrauber (SHS) designation.

Though unarmed, it's easy to handle and has quite a nice flight model.

While Hawkeye created the model and Snorri made up the textures, Helifreak was responsible for importing it for Operation Flashpoint.

Detailled Description:

Quote[/b] ]As a replacement for the ageing Alouette II helicopters used for

basic training, the German Army Aviation formulated a requirement

in the late 90s for a suitable successor model. It was outlined that

the new helicopter should make use of fly-by-wire (FBW) controls to

allow crew training for future rotorcraft such as the Tiger and NH90

helicopters both featuring FBS controls.

The choice fell on the EC135, which already was in service with German

police helicopter squadrons and air rescue services. Although based

on the civilian EC135 rather than the military variant EC635

Eurocopter is offering as well, the SHS features distintive differences

due to the specific requirements of military flight training.

These changes include a higher landing gear for touch-and-go maneuvers

on mountain flanks, extended communication equipment and a NVG compatible

cockpit.

One year late, the first of 15 EC135 SHS was delivered in September 2000.

They are being used exclusively for crew training at the Army Aviation

School (Heeresfliegerwaffenschule) in Bückeburg.

The problem with the (BIS) logo is not related to this addon.

In OFP, those are used when a player uses a clanlogo.

It will apear only in multiplayer and when the player uses a squad.xml.

The problem is most likely caused by another addon which is not made properly.
